Queens, NY (PRWEB) July 2, 2006 -- Queens Book Fair extends early registration bonus due to overwhelming response from authors. This year's book fair will be held on August 19, 2006 at Rufus King Park in Jamaica, New York. Last year the Queens Book Fair was held on April 30, 2005 and was featured in Newsday, May 3, 2005, article "This book fair’s for the self-published" New York City Edition Neighborhoods section pg. A52.

Self-published authors from around the country flocked the 2005 Queens Book Fair, along with book lovers around the tri-state area.

Authors will participating from a variety of genres such as fiction, non-fiction, romance, mystery, children's books, etc. Book lovers from around the tri-state area will be attending to support both published and self-published authors from around the country. Authors will be signing their books for consumers.

The 2nd Annual Queens Book Fair is pleased to announce RushPRnews.com and NYCblacksearch.com as media sponsor for the upcoming 2nd Annual Queens Book Fair.
